Overview

The Raymarine AIS250 Receiver module is a 'listen only' AIS receiver that easily integrates with an existing VHF antenna using a built in VHF splitter. The AIS250 then interfaces to Raymarine multifunction displays, allowing AIS targets to be graphically overlaid in both the chartplotter and radar modes.

 

Operating in the VHF maritime band, the AIS system enables the wireless exchange of navigation status between vessels and shore-side traffic monitoring centers. Commercial ships, ocean going vessels and other boats equipped with AIS transmitters broadcast AIS messages that include the vessel’s name, course, speed, and current navigation status.

AIS250 Features

  • Monitoring of class A and B AIS broadcasts
  • Overlay AIS targets on Raymarine multifunction displays in both chartplotter
    and radar modes
  • AIS target tracking enhances your situational awareness by monitoring a target’s name, course, speed, and navigation status
  • Reconcile AIS targets with radar targets for added safety
  • Built-in VHF/FM antenna splitter. No additional antenna required
  • Two NMEA 0183 inputs (1 @38,400 and 1 @ 4800 bps)
  • Two NMEA 0183 output ports (1 @38,400 and 1 @ 4800 bps)
  • Built-in multiplexer enables C or E Series to receive both AIS data and one other NMEA 0183 data source through a single port.

Specifications

  • Channel Spacing: 25 kHz
  • Antenna Impedance: 50 Ohm
  • NMEA 0183 Sentence: VDM
  • Data Format: NMEA 0183
  • NMEA 0183 Baud Rate: 38,400/4800 Baud
  • Warranty: 2 years parts, 2 year labor
  • Dimensions: 6.69”H x 9.33”W x 2.16”D (170 mm × 237 mm x 55mm)
  • Weight: 1.2 lbs (.54Kg)
  • Power: DC 10.8~32V @ <200mA (12 or 24 Volt Systems)
  • AIS Data Rate: 9600 BpS
  • Storage Temperature: -4 to 167° F (-20° to 75° C)
  • AIS Receiver Type: Dual Channel (multiplexed)
  • Operating Frequencies: 161.975 and 162.025 MHz (multiplexed)
  • Sensitivity: <-109dBm (receiver only)
  • Operating Temperature: 14° to 131° F (-10° to 55° C)
